When iron and sulfur combine to form iron sulfide, a chemical reaction occurs where iron atoms lose electrons to sulfur atoms, forming a compound with a new chemical structure. This reaction is exothermic, releasing energy in the form of heat.

Iron impurities can react with oxygen from the air to form iron oxide, commonly known as rust. This reaction occurs due to the oxidation of iron atoms in the presence of moisture and oxygen. Rust can weaken the iron structure and cause it to deteriorate over time.
When iron is added to lead chloride, no reaction occurs since iron is less reactive than lead. Iron will not displace lead in the compound to form a new substance.

The chemical reaction in which iron combines with oxygen to form iron oxide is called rusting. This reaction occurs when iron is exposed to oxygen and moisture in the air, leading to the formation of iron oxide, commonly known as rust.
